Prioritizing Safety and Comfort
Before diving into storage, let's consider personal comfort and safety. Eye and ear protection are non-negotiable. A sturdy range bag is also crucial for transporting your gear comfortably and securely. Consider padded compartments to protect sensitive items. Don't forget essentials like sunscreen, a hat, and water to stay comfortable throughout the day.
Ammo Mastery: Storage and Organization
Effective organization starts with your ammunition. Loose boxes and scattered rounds can be a nightmare. This is where proper ammo storage cases become invaluable. Sturdy, stackable cases protect your ammunition from the elements and prevent damage. They also help you quickly identify what you have and how much, saving precious time. Look for cases with secure latches and durable construction that can withstand the rigors of transport and storage. EDC Essentials: Tailoring Your Carry
Your EDC, or everyday carry, should be tailored to your specific needs on the range. Consider what tools and accessories you'll need quick access to. A well-organized pouch or small bag worn on your person can be incredibly helpful. Think about carrying a small knife, a multi-tool, or a specialized tool for loading or maintenance. The key is to minimize bulk while maximizing accessibility.
Enhanced Grip and Control
Consistent grip is essential for accurate and controlled handling. If you find your grip fatiguing or slipping, consider grip sleeves. These sleeves slide over your equipment, providing a more textured and comfortable surface to hold. A better grip translates to improved control and reduced hand fatigue, especially during extended training. Maximizing Efficiency: A Structured Approach
Implement a system for organizing your gear both before and after your range day. Pre-packing your range bag with a checklist ensures you don't forget anything essential. After your range day, take the time to clean and reorganize your gear. This not only extends the lifespan of your equipment but also saves you time and frustration on future outings. Designate specific compartments or containers for different types of items to maintain a streamlined and efficient system.
